Work will include but is not limited to, preparing soil, tilling, seeding, picking rocks, operating

farm equipment such as but not limited to, tractor, and forklift. Workers will use tools, such as

but not limited to, shovel, hoe, and rake. Handling, grading, inspecting seeds and soil in

preparation for potato harvest, as well as, repairing pallet boxes, pallets, other farm

implements, and farm buildings that apply to the agricultural job. Worker requires bending,

stooping, lifting and carrying 50lbs on a frequent basis. One month experience in all job duties

listed required.
